
Understanding Sovereign AI in the Context of Global Competition
Sovereign AI is quickly becoming a pivotal concept in the ongoing tech rivalry between the United States and China. Initiatives by companies like OpenAI aim to establish AI systems tailored to the needs of individual nations, particularly democracies that prioritize data sovereignty and ethical AI use. As concerns mount over dependence on foreign technology, countries are investing heavily in domestic AI capabilities, prompting a reevaluation of how AI can be integrated with national policies to bolster economic competitiveness.
The Rise of AI Sovereignty
The notion of “sovereign AI” centers on the ability of nations to develop their own AI technologies using local resources, regulation, and talent. Countries around the world are investing billions to create infrastructure that supports this autonomy, mirroring historical shifts in the semiconductor industry. Nations like India, the UAE, and France are positioning themselves to not only develop AI based on local needs but also reduce reliance on dominant tech groups like those in Silicon Valley. This shift is driven by a confluence of factors including national security concerns, economic resilience, and a desire for local customization.
Global Investment Trends in AI
According to a recent Bain & Company report, local data center providers are set to account for nearly 25% of new computing capacity worldwide as governments subsidize domestic AI initiatives. These moves are crucial, especially since AI development is increasingly reliant on open-source models that allow for quicker entry into markets. However, a significant question persists: can these sovereign AI projects truly compete with the established giants?
Challenges and Opportunities Ahead
Despite the momentum for sovereign AI, significant challenges remain. Major tech incumbents possess advantages in terms of scale and financial resources, which may hinder the growth of emerging domestic competitors. Strategists warn of potential overcapacity in data centers as governments rush to build infrastructure without estimating true demand. Additionally, ethical considerations must guide the development of AI in different political contexts, which is an uphill battle when dealing with non-democratic regimes.
Strategic Partnerships: A Double-Edged Sword
OpenAI’s partnerships with countries like the UAE exemplify the complex dynamics of sovereign AI. While such collaborations can help countries enhance their tech capabilities, they also risk entrenching existing power structures. Critics argue that engaging with authoritarian governments could compromise the liberalization goals set by proponents of sovereign AI. It raises the question: can the engagement strategy truly lead to positive change, or will it merely reinforce existing hierarchies?
